Sainsbury's

If you're looking to buy your favorite UK products, online grocery shopping at Sainsbury's is an excellent option. You can make a list of items you love to help you order them. You can also sign up for regular delivery which will save you money on delivery fees.

Sainsbury's, a leading UK retailer with more than 1,400 stores as well as an online is the biggest retailer in the country. John James Sainsbury founded the company in 1869 in Drury Lane in London with his wife Mary Ann. It has a reputation for excellent customer service, and is known for its variety of quality foods and drinks.

The primary focus of the company is on food but it also operates a range of other retail businesses such as home furnishings and clothing. The UK supermarket market is dominating by the Big Four. Tesco, Sainsbury's Asda and Morrisons are the four major players. Lidl, Aldi and smaller grocery chains follow. Furthermore, the market is filled with online retailers and discounters.

Sainsbury's one of the top supermarkets in the UK offers a broad range of products from frozen and fresh foods to household items and cosmetics. Sainsbury's sells brand names in addition to its own range of products. Sainsbury's own brands include Be Good to Yourself!, My Goodness! and Free From. It also offers a range of gluten-free and organic products. Sainsbury's also offers its customers a unique rewards program, called Nectar that gives loyalty points on purchases made in stores or at online.

Aldi On the other hand, has smaller selection of goods however, it offers some of the most affordable prices in the nation. The motto of the store is "less is more," and it focuses on own-brand products to reduce costs. 90% of the items are their own and they can save money on packaging and branding. They also require their suppliers to deliver their products in boxes that are ready for shelf which helps cut costs.

Weezy is an app that provides groceries, household goods, and other products from local businesses. They deliver fresh produce, meat from a London butcher, and even board games and toys like Twister and Jenga! The Weezy app is available in Bristol, Brighton, and large areas of central London.
